30 | 30 | | An Act establishing a special commission to investigate and study the feasibility of establishing a |
---|
31 | 31 | | municipal building financing authority. |
---|
32 | 32 | |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Court assembled, and by the authority |
---|
33 | 33 | | of the same, as follows: |
---|
34 | 34 | | 1 SECTION 1. There is hereby established a special commission to investigate and study |
---|
35 | 35 | | 2the feasibility of establishing a municipal building finance authority. |
---|
36 | 36 | | 3 SECTION 2. The commission shall: (1) consider recommendations from state and federal |
---|
37 | 37 | | 4reports, relative to the establishment of a municipal building finance authority; (2) identify and |
---|
38 | 38 | | 5consider state and private funding sources with consideration for providing grants and loans to |
---|
39 | 39 | | 6cities and towns for the planning, design, and construction of municipal buildings; (3) assess |
---|
40 | 40 | | 7innovative financing approaches for assisting municipalities in the planning and construction of |
---|
41 | 41 | | 8municipal buildings including, but not limited to, councils-on-aging facilities, public safety |
---|
42 | 42 | | 9facilities, town halls, and other municipal buildings or facilities; and (4) determine specific 2 of 2 |
---|
43 | 43 | | 10powers of a municipal building finance authority including but not limited to (a) establishing |
---|
44 | 44 | | 11grant programs, (b) providing architectural or other technical advice and assistance to |
---|
45 | 45 | | 12municipalities, general contractors, subcontractors, construction or project managers, designers |
---|
46 | 46 | | 13and others in the planning, maintenance and establishment of municipal facilities; (c) perform or |
---|
47 | 47 | | 14commission a needs survey to ascertain the capital construction, reconstruction, maintenance and |
---|
48 | 48 | | 15other capital needs for municipal facilities in the commonwealth, and (d) recommend to the |
---|
49 | 49 | | 16general court legislation as necessary to further the purposes of establishing a municipal building |
---|
50 | 50 | | 17finance authority. |
---|
51 | 51 | | 18 SECTION 2. The municipal building finance commission shall be comprised of the |
---|
52 | 52 | | 19following 13 members: 2 members of the senate appointed by the senate president; 2 members |
---|
53 | 53 | | 20of the house of representatives appointed by the speaker of the house; 1 member of the senate |
---|
54 | 54 | | 21and 1 member of the house of representatives appointed by the minority leader of each; the state |
---|
55 | 55 | | 22treasurer or a designee, the secretary of administration and finance or a designee, the secretary of |
---|
56 | 56 | | 23public safety and security or a designee, the secretary of elder affairs or a designee; the secretary |
---|
57 | 57 | | 24of housing and economic development or a designee; the executive director of the school |
---|
58 | 58 | | 25building authority or a designee and a representative of the Massachusetts Municipal |
---|
59 | 59 | | 26Association. |
---|
60 | 60 | | 27 The members of the commission shall be appointed not later than 90 days after the |
---|
61 | 61 | | 28effective date of this act and shall serve until the completion of the report. |
---|
62 | 62 | | 29 SECTION 3. The commission shall report to the general court the results of its study |
---|
63 | 63 | | 30together with recommendations and drafts of legislation by filing the same with the clerks of the |
---|
64 | 64 | | 31senate and the house of representatives on or before December 31, 2024. |
